Transaction d15bebdeb366a73f11ccdb14833f54c2652dfb4a008a101e88dd5f3b8222d2ec

4 Input
1 Outputs
  • d15bebdeb366a73f11ccdb14833f54c2652dfb4a008a101e88dd5f3b8222d2ec:0
  • value  24498147
    address  1HDWAto9mD4vwZkxE7RZ4nxvgYcA5vJQpG